| 7BM76: Correlated Receiver Diversity Simulations with R&S®SFU | 12.12.2011 |
| Receiver diversity improves reception quality by using multiple antennas with a preferably low correlation factor between each other. This results in a more robust handling of multipath signals, since a deep fade will then not affect all received signals at the same time. However, the compact dimensions of handheld devices can introduce unwanted correlation due to their dense antenna spacing. In this case, the popular diversity test setup consisting of several independent transmitters will no longer serve the needs of a realistic simulation, since correlation effects have to be taken into account here. A clever solution is to operate the R&S®SFU in split-fading mode in combination with a second transmitter. This can be another R&S®SFU, the R&S®SFE, the R&S®SFE100 or the R&S®SMU200A. In this way, two diversity signals of adjustable correlation for any common broadcast standard are coded in realtime, while their individual multipath profile is precisely specified by the extensive features of the R&S®SFU fader module.

| 1MA135: Path Compensation for MS Fading Tests | 22.01.2011 |
| As well as static tests, modern mobile communication standards also stipulate measurements under fading conditions, sometimes with additional white gaussian noise AWGN. Rohde & Schwarz supports these tests with the combination of the R&S®CMU200 Radio Communication Tester and the R&S®SMU200A or R&S®AMU200A Vector / Baseband Signal Generator and Fading Simulator. Applying fading and noise always raises the crest factor of a signal considerably. Thus, automatic path attenuation inside the R&S® baseband fader prevents the new signal peaks from being clipped at I/Q full scale. Any additional attenuation in the baseband, however, makes the RF output fall below its intended level. This application note shows how to achieve an accurate RF output level by compensating for the I/Q attenuation - without modifying the test setup or using additional instruments.

| 1GPAN28: Frequency Hopping for GSM Base Station Tests with Signal Generators SME | 22.01.2011 |
| While Mobile phones are allowed to require approximately 3 time slots for switching from transmission to reception, base stations must be able to transmit and receive at a new frequency in every time slot in the frequency hopping mode. This behaviour must of course be tested and measurements carried out on the base station transmitter and receiver. Since there is no signal generator which is able to settle at different frequencies from one to the next time slot with GSM modulation, a solution to this problem was found by linking two Signal Generators SME in such a way that they alternately provide signals at different frequencies.

| 1GPAN03: Double frequency range for R&S Signal Generators | 22.01.2011 |
| Leaving aside the microwave generators, the present line of Rohde & Schwarz products comprisessignal generators up to 1 GHz (SMX, SMG), up to 2 GHz (SMH, SMGU), up to 3 GHz (SME, SMT) and up to 4.3 GHz (SMHU). For applications at higher frequencies, all signal generators can also be operated with an external passive frequency doubler. This extends the range of possible applications up to 8.6 GHz. Some degraded specs regarding level and modulation are described below. For people using the frequency range 3 to 6 GHz, the low priced combination SMT plus frequency doubler will mainly be interesting. Signal generator SMHU is useful for the frequency range up to 8.6 GHz. Especially the phase noise performance is excellent with this instrument. the required output signal. It should also be pointed out that the residual FM and the SSB phase noise will be 6 dB poorer as a result of frequency doubling.

| 1GPAN26: Base Station Adjacent Time Slot Rejection Measurement with R&S®CMD and R&S®SME | 22.01.2011 |
| In radio networks using TDMA, such as GSM, PCN (DCS1800) and PCS (DCS1900), reception and demodulation of data transmitted in a time slot may be impaired by signals and data of the adjacent time slots. This could be the case if a mobile which is far away from the base station is using time slot e.g. 4, while two other mobiles very close to the base station are using the time slots 3 and 5. In order to get highest performance measurements the suppression of adjacent time slot signals are prescribed for base station receivers. For instance, GSM specifications (ETSI/GSM 11.20) stipulate for base stations BER tolerances for a used time slot in the presence of a 50-dB higher level in the adjacent time slots while all other time slot are switched off. This measurement problem can be solved with the signal generator SME synchronised on the base station radio communication tester CMD 54 or CMD 57.

| 1GP66: Selecting a Signal Generator for Testing AD Converters | 22.01.2011 |
| Analog-to-digital converters (ADCs) have taken giant steps in speed over the past decade: Sampling rates of 250 mega-samples per second at 16-bit resolution are now commonplace. Such devices allow high-speed video processing and even software defined radio (SDR) applications, where digitization is being performed at ever-higher intermediate frequencies (IF). This has clearly raised the bar for ADC test equipment, especially regarding the noise performance of the analog input signal and sample clock sources used in the test setup. Since the price of a signal source rises with performance, carefully selecting a generator with the most suitable specifications has become worthwhile if not mandatory.

| 1GPAN35: Generation of Test Signals for IS-136 (NADC) with Signal Generator SME | 22.01.2011 |
| Communication systems according to IS-136 (NADC) use Time Division Multiplex Access (TDMA) for the communication between base station and mobile stations. There are 6 time slots available. Depending on the amount of data, which have to be transmitted, the system uses full rate channels or half rate channels. A full rate channel means, that the mobile is accessed every 3rd time slot (e.g time slot 1 and 3, time slot 2 and 4 or time slot 3 and 6). With half rate channels the mobile is accessed every 6th time slot. Full rate and half rate channels may be mixed on demand. The base stations transmit continous on their frequency. Depending on the used combination of full rate and half rate channels the base station uses a different sequence of synchronisation words. The mobile stations use bursted transmission with one of the synchronisation words S1 to S6 defined in the standard. Signal Generator SME is excellently suited to generate these signals to test either base station receivers or mobile phone receivers. Together with the modulation data supplied with this application note the SME serves as a signal source for various test and measurement applications in the whole frequency range of IS-136 (NADC).

| 1GPAN14: Simulation of BCCH Channel of GSM/PCN Base Station with Signal Generator SME | 22.01.2011 |
| Propagation measurements are indispensable in the planning of digital, cellular mobile radio net-works. To find the optimum sites for the base stations, a mobile test transmitter system simulating the base station is operated from a number of possible locations. The test receiver system is accommodated in a vehicle, which is driven along a test route to perform measurements. The parameters measured, such as level, bit error rate or channel impulse response, provide information on the coverage within the cell. The main problem is to minimize interference caused by multipath propagation in the reception area. The SME offered by Rohde & Schwarz is a universal test generator that can be used as the core of a test transmitter system. The SME generates the GMSK-modulated signals required for GSM propagation measurements in line with the rele-vant standards. Thanks to its low weight of 17 kg it can be carried even to remote sites. Fitted with the new optional DM Memory Extension (SME-B12, in the following referred to as XMEM), the SME is able to store data sequences of up to 8 Mbit which are long enough for receiver measurements with test mobile stations. A suitable test receiver system is for instance a test mobile station for measuring level and bit error rate and the Impulse Response Analyzer PCS from Rohde & Schwarz for measuring the channel impulse response. The present Application Note describes how the XMEM can be loaded with suitable data (test sequence) by the GSM Radiocommunication Test Set CRTP from Rohde & Schwarz and how the SME has to be adjusted for GMSK modulation of these data. First, however, an overview is given of all functions of the XMEM and their operation supplementary to the Operating Manual. Finally, it is explained how the XMEM data can be transferred between PC and SME via the IEEE-488 or RS-232 interface.
